Crime Rate In Orange Beach, AL Summary

Crime in Orange Beach research summary. HomeSnacks has been using Saturday Night Science to report crime data in Orange Beach over the past eight years using the FBI Crime Explorer. Based on the most recently available data released on October 17, 2023, we found the following about crime in Orange Beach:

  • There were 191 total crimes committed in Orange Beach in the last reporting year.
  • On a rate basis, there were 2,202.2 total crimes per 100K people in Orange Beach.
  • The overall crime rate in Orange Beach is 3.92% above the national average.
  • Orange Beach ranks #167 safest out of 278 cities in Alabama.
  • Orange Beach ranks #7,603 safest out of 9,896 cities in the United States.

Because the crime rate is so low in America, we use "per 100,000 people" to make the number a bit easier to compare across locations visually. It's mathematically the same as per capita comparisons and isn't meant to convey that 100,000+ people live in a location.

Orange Beach Vs Alabama And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Orange Beach is 2,202.2 per 100,000 people. That's 3.92% higher than the national rate of 2,119.2 per 100,000 people and 14.41% higher than the Alabama total crime rate of 1,924.9 per 100,000 people.

Violent Crime Rates In Orange Beach

  • There were 31 violent crimes in Orange Beach in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in Orange Beach is 357.4 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 279.8 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in Orange Beach each year. That compares to a 1 in 277.9 chance statewide.
  • That's -0.44% lower than the national rate of 359.0 per 100,000 people.
  • And -0.68% lower than the Alabama violent crime rate of 359.9 per 100,000 people.
